Man Posing as Reporter Held for Intimidation, Assault in Hyderabad
Hyderabad, Aug 14 (TNT): Mehdipatnam Police have registered a case against a 32-year-old man who allegedly intimidated a woman by claiming to be a media reporter and later assaulted her. The accused was arrested and remanded to judicial custody, police said on Friday.
The accused, Arif Hussain (32), a resident of Rahul Colony, Tolichowki, works as a reporter for SNZ YouTube News Channel, according to police.
Police said Hussain allegedly used his position as a reporter to threaten and intimidate the woman.
Acting on a complaint lodged by the 31-year-old victim , police registered a case and initiated an investigation.
A case was registered under Sections 64(2)(m) and 123 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S) and Section 7 read with Section 8 of the POCSO Act, police said.
Following the investigation, Hussain was taken into custody and produced before the court, which remanded him to judicial custody.
Mehdipatnam Inspector S Mallesh advised people not to succumb to intimidation or threats from individuals misusing their position or designation and urged them to report such incidents to the police through Dial-112.
Strict legal action would be taken against those found intimidating, harassing or threatening people by misusing their position, the Inspector added.
